Появление сообщения «Файл защищен от просмотра» или «Ячейка защищена от изменений» блокирует возможность внести правки в таблицу, требуя немедленного снятия ограничений через меню рецензирования или настройки атрибута файла. Часто пользователь сталкивается с ситуацией, когда документ открывается в режиме «Только для чтения», что делает невозможным сохранение изменений по текущему пути или требует ввода пароля для разблокировки функционала. Устранение этой проблемы зависит от типа примененной защиты: это может быть блокировка всего файла операциной системой, защита структуры книги или ограничение на изменение конкретных ячеек внутри листа.
Прежде чем приступать к сложным манипуляциям, необходимо определить уровень блокировки, так как методы снятия защиты кардинально отличаются. Если файл помечен как «Только для чтения» в свойствах Windows, то программные методы внутри Excel не помогут. В случае, когда активна защита листа, интерфейс программы позволяет взаимодействовать с данными, но запрещает их модификацию. Понимание источника проблемы — ключ к быстрому восстановлению доступа к редактированию.
В некоторых случаях ограничение накладывается корпоративными политиками безопасности или файл был сохранен с макросами, блокирующими действия пользователя. Важно различать эти сценарии, чтобы не пытаться взломать пароль там, где нужно просто изменить атрибут файла. Ниже приведены детальные алгоритмы действий для каждого типа блокировки, от простых настроек свойств до использования специального софта для восстановления доступа.
Диагностика типа блокировки файла
Первым шагом всегда должна стать точная диагностика, так как попытка снять защиту листа через меню «Рецензирование» бесполезна, если файл заблокирован на уровне файловой системы. Обратите внимание на заголовок окна программы: если там присутствует пометка «Только для чтения» [Read-Only], проблема кроется в атрибутах файла или правах доступа к папке. В этом случае стандартные инструменты Excel могут быть недоступны или неэффективны.
Если же файл открывается нормально, но при попытке ввода данных в ячейку всплывает окно с требованием ввести пароль, значит, активирована защита конкретного листа или всей книги. Такой тип блокировки настраивается через вкладку Рецензирование и предназначен для предотвращения случайного изменения формул или структуры таблицы. Также стоит проверить, не является ли файл финальной версией, помеченной автором как «Пометить как окончательную», что переводит документ в режим просмотра.
⚠️ Внимание: Если файл получен из ненадежного источника и при открытии желтая полоса безопасности блокирует редактирование, это функция «Защищенного просмотра». Не отключайте её, если не уверены в безопасности вложения.
Для точного определения типа защиты выполните следующие действия:
- 🔍 Проверьте заголовок окна Excel на наличие надписи «Только для чтения» или «Защищенный просмотр».
- 🔍 Попробуйте перейти на вкладку «Рецензирование» и посмотреть, активна ли кнопка «Снять защиту с листа».
- 🔍 Закройте файл, нажмите на него правой кнопкой мыши в проводнике и выберите «Свойства», чтобы проверить атрибуты.
Снятие защиты с листа и книги в Excel
Наиболее распространенный сценарий — это необходимость разблокировать лист, на который автором был установлен пароль. Если вы знаете пароль или он не был установлен (защита снята без пароля по умолчанию), процедура занимает несколько секунд. Перейдите на вкладку Рецензирование в ленте меню и найдите группу инструментов «Защита».
Если лист защищен, кнопка будет называться «Снять защиту с листа». При нажатии на нее система может запросить пароль. В случае успешного ввода или его отсутствия, ограничение снимается, и все ячейки становятся доступны для редактирования. Аналогично снимается и защита структуры книги, которая запрещает добавление, переименование или удаление листов.
☑️ Алгоритм снятия защиты листа
Важно понимать разницу между защитой листа и защитой книги. Первая ограничивает действия с ячейками (ввод данных, форматирование), вторая — действия с самими листами (перемещение, копирование). Для снятия обоих типов ограничений используются разные команды в одной и той же вкладке меню. Если пароль утерян, стандартными средствами Excel снять такую защиту невозможно из соображений безопасности.
| Тип защиты | Расположение команды | Что блокирует | Нужен пароль |
|---|---|---|---|
| Защита листа | Рецензирование → Снять защиту | Изменение содержимого ячеек | Да (если установлен) |
| Защита книги | Рецензирование → Защитить книгу | Структуру (листы, окна) | Да (если установлен) |
| Защита файла | Файл → Сведения → Защитить | Открытие или модификацию файла | Да (обязательно) |
| Ограничить доступ | Файл → Сведения → Ограничить доступ | Права пользователей (IRM) | Да (права доступа) |
Устранение статуса «Только для чтения»
Статус «Только для чтения» часто возникает не из-за настроек Excel, а из-за атрибутов файла в операционной системе Windows. Это может случиться после скачивания файла из интернета, получения по электронной почте или копирования с защищенного носителя. В таком случае программа Excel открывает файл, но не дает сохранить изменения под тем же именем.
Чтобы убрать этот запрет, закройте файл и найдите его в проводнике. Нажмите на иконку файла правой кнопкой мыши и выберите пункт «Свойства». В нижней части окна свойств найдите атрибут «Только для чтения» и снимите с него галочку. После применения изменений файл станет доступен для полной записи.
Почему файл становится «Только для чтения»?
Файл может получить этот статус, если он открыт другим пользователем в сети, если диск переполнен, или если файл находится в системной папке, требующей прав администратора. Также антивирусные программы могут временно блокировать запись в скачанные файлы до проверки.»
Иногда файл помечается как «Только для чтения» самим Excel, если он был неправильно закрыт в предыдущий раз. В этом случае при открытии может появиться панель сообщений с кнопкой «Включить редактирование». Нажатие этой кнопки снимает временные ограничения сеанса. Если же файл сохранен в облачном хранилище (OneDrive, SharePoint), убедитесь, что у вас есть права на редактирование в веб-интерфейсе сервиса.
Работа с макросами и форматом файлов
Формат файла играет критическую роль в возможности редактирования. Файлы с расширением .xlsm содержат макросы, которые могут программно блокировать интерфейс пользователя. Если при открытии файла включается макрос, отключающий ввод данных, стандартные методы снятия защиты не сработают до тех пор, пока макрос не будет остановлен.
Для проверки этого сценария откройте файл, удерживая клавишу Shift, что предотвратит автоматический запуск макросов при открытии (автооткрытие). Если после этого файл стал доступен для редактирования, значит, проблема кроется в коде VBA. В этом случае необходимо перейти в редактор макросов (нажав Alt + F11) и проверить модули на наличие процедур блокировки.
- 💻 Проверьте расширения файлов: .xlsx не поддерживает макросы, а .xlsm — поддерживает.
- 💻 Используйте «Безопасный режим» Excel для запуска программы без надстроек и макросов.
- 💻 Отключите выполнение макросов в настройках центра управления безопасностью для диагностики.
Также стоит упомянуть формат .xls (старый формат Excel 97-2003). Он имеет менее совершенную систему защиты и может некорректно отображать статус защиты в новых версиях Excel. Конвертация такого файла в современный формат .xlsx через «Сохранить как» иногда помогает сбросить ошибочные флаги блокировки, если пароль не установлен.
Использование сторонних инструментов и онлайн-сервисов
В ситуациях, когда пароль утерян, а доступ к данным необходим, пользователи часто обращаются к сторонним решениям. Существуют специализированные программы и онлайн-сервисы, которые используют методы подбора паролей (brute-force) или уязвимости в алгоритмах шифрования старых версий Excel. Однако использование таких методов требует осторожности и понимания рисков.
Онлайн-сервисы предлагают загрузить защищенный файл и получить разблокированную версию. Категорически не рекомендуется загружать файлы, содержащие персональные данные, коммерческую тайну или финансовую отчетность, на неизвестные сервера. Безопасность ваших данных в таком случае не гарантируется, и файл может быть скопирован третьими лицами.
⚠️ Внимание: Использование программ для взлома паролей может нарушать законодательство и правила использования программного обеспечения. Применяйте такие методы только к файлам, владельцем которых вы являетесь.
Для корпоративных сред существуют легальные инструменты восстановления доступа, предоставляемые администраторами IT-инфраструктуры. Если файл защищен правами IRM (Information Rights Management), то снять защиту можно только получив соответствующие права от владельца документа через сервер политики организации. Локальные методы здесь бессильны.
Профилактика потери доступа к данным
Чтобы избежать ситуаций, когда требуется экстренно убирать запрет на редактирование, следует грамотно подходить к настройке защиты. Не используйте защиту листа как основной метод конфиденциальности, так как она легко обходится. Для защиты важных данных используйте шифрование всего файла паролем при сохранении.
Регулярно создавайте резервные копии файлов перед установкой любых ограничений. Это позволит вернуться к рабочей версии, если в процессе настройки защиты вы случайно заблокируете себе доступ или забудете пароль. Ведение версионности документов — лучшая стратегия работы с важными таблицами.
Также рекомендуется использовать функцию «Разрешить изменение диапазонов», которая позволяет создать исключения для определенных ячеек без снятия общей защиты. Это дает гибкость в работе: пользователи могут вводить данные в отведенные места, но не могут ломать формулы или структуру отчета. Настройка этой функции находится в меню «Рецензирование» → «Разрешить изменение диапазонов».
Можно ли убрать защиту листа Excel без пароля?
Официальными средствами Excel — нет. Защита листа является элементом безопасности. Однако, если файл имеет формат .xlsx (XML-based), существуют технические способы извлечения данных или снятия защиты путем редактирования внутренней структуры файла (переименование в .zip и изменение XML-кода), но это требует технических навыков.
Почему кнопка «Снять защиту с листа» неактивна (серая)?
Это означает, что на текущем листе не установлена защита, либо файл открыт в режиме совместимости или защищенного просмотра. Также кнопка может быть недоступна, если workbook защищен структурой, и сначала нужно снять защиту с книги.
Как защитить ячейку с формулой от изменений?
По умолчанию все ячейки в Excel заблокированы, но блокировка вступает в силу только после включения защиты листа. Чтобы защитить только формулу, выделите все остальные ячейки, откройте формат ячеек (Ctrl+1), перейдите на вкладку «Защита» и снимите галочку «Защищаемая ячейка». Затем включите защиту листа.
Что делать, если забыт пароль на открытие файла?
Если забыт пароль на открытие (шифрование файла), восстановить данные практически невозможно в современных версиях Excel (2013 и новее) из-за использования стойких алгоритмов шифрования AES. Помочь могут только специализированные сервисы по подбору паролей, но успех не гарантирован.